As much as I appreciate Wayback Machine, it's the responsibility of authors to choose an authoring format that can stand the test of time, at least for content you care about. HTML is built on a rich foundation of markup languages which is more than adequate for preservation. Just that it renders in a browser isn't good enough as browsers have turned into overly complex monstrosities with a high risk of loosing further browser code bases going forward (eg. Moz loosing their Google deal, and developing browsers becoming economically infeasible) at which point we're at the mercy of an ad company to even read our documents.
